Output 826d93036e5e157c55b7294c5997937a89f4d54bba240b12b05017e8c75adcaf:30

value
252576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72fbae8ec7524854df66ef0f1e74b6d9e44e2165 OP_EQUAL
address
3CAzTaJiyK7Nwhz8TqomsBD8dY4sVqWQt3
transaction
826d93036e5e157c55b7294c5997937a89f4d54bba240b12b05017e8c75adcaf
confirmations
62585
spent
true